ARMENIA PARTICIPATING UN ECOSOC SESSIONJuly 2, 2004 - 23:52 AMT PanARMENIAN.Net - Armenia is for the first time taking part in the annual session of the United Nations Department of Economic and Social Affairs (ECOSOC) as a member of this organization. As reported by Armenian MFA press service, head of the State Committee Cadastre of Real Estate under the RA government Manuk Vardanian stated when addressing the session that poverty reduction is one of the principal tasks for Armenia. "This issue urges the mobilization of domestic and external resources as well as cooperation between financial organizations with active engagement of private business", Vardanian noted. In his words, direct investments and state assistance are the significant components of the development. In this view he underscored the importance of Armenia's including in the list of the countries eligible for Millenium Challenge Account.
